Group Formats

In-Person groups

Meet at East End CHC 1619 Queen Street East (at Coxwell Ave). Registration is required as there is room capacity limit. Masks are optional at the Centre. Please do not attend a group program if you have a cough, fever or cold symptoms.

Hybrid groups

Meet virtually over zoom and in person at the Centre at the same time. Registration is required as there is room capacity limit for the in-person group.

Virtual groups

Meet on Zoom and requires access to an electronic device (computer, phone, or tablet) and a WIFI connection.

Improve strength, flexibility, and balance. Relieve pain, enhance sleep, and boost mood. Tai Chi involves slow, gentle movements, postures, meditation, and controlled breathing. Drop-in Wednesdays from 1:00 – 2:00 PM.
